Couldn't get it to sync

Open nhan000 opened this issue 2 years ago • 7 comments

Hi I don't know what's wrong with my setup but the plugin doesn't do anything. image

I have clicked the hypothesis icon on the ribbon and run command to trigger manual sync but nothing happened. I have close and restart Obsidian, tried the plugin on multiple vaults, and restart my PC, but nothing worked. Please let me know where I have set things up wrong.

Edit: After posting this I got it to run somehow on 1 of the 3 vaults I tried. However, it still didn't do anything image

I certainly have highlights in my hypothesis account, but no idea why it doesn't sync. image

For anyone who ran into the same issue as me the problem seems to be that I have ~ 380 highlights and it can't be imported properly and that prevented the plugin from loading.
